Guessing this is physically impossible without a lot of work. The Zastavas chambered in 375 H&H use a cut out action that is just long enough for SAAMI specs. Given the shorter nature of the 458 win mag I would have to assume they do not cut them out to the degree they would with the 375 H&H so one would also have the ream out the action to get the Lott in there.

That said I own a Zastava in 375 H&H and I would recommend against them for African use. There are too many issues with the cut action that can cause problems in the field VS using a proper magnum action(plus it's only 3+1). As a hunting rifle I like mine, but if I had to go back I'd get a CZ 550 and if I was going to Africa the CZ 550 would be my minimum for quality and functionality.
